#17851: kmymoney 0.9.2 failing to build due dyld: Symbol not found ---------------------------------+------------------------------------------ Reporter: dorneles@… | Owner: macports-tickets@… Type: defect | Status: new Priority: Normal | Milestone: Port Enhancements Component: ports | Version: 1.7.0 Keywords: | Port: ---------------------------------+------------------------------------------ Hello folks, I'm trying to update kmymoney Portfile to use the latest version (0.9.2) but it's failing with the following error message: {{{ dyld: lazy symbol binding failed: Symbol not found: __ZN11MyMoneyFileC1Ev Referenced from: /opt/local/var/macports/build/_Users_dorneles_ports_kde_kmymoney/work/kmymoney2-0.9.2/kmymoney2/widgets/.libs/libkmymoney.0.0.0.dylib Expected in: flat namespace dyld: Symbol not found: __ZN11MyMoneyFileC1Ev Referenced from: /opt/local/var/macports/build/_Users_dorneles_ports_kde_kmymoney/work/kmymoney2-0.9.2/kmymoney2/widgets/.libs/libkmymoney.0.0.0.dylib Expected in: flat namespace }}} I contacted kmymoney folks, but they don't have a clue about how to fix the above problem. For the complete reference, including the Portfile that I'm using and the entire conversation, please check: http://thread.gmane.org/gmane.comp.kde.kmymoney2.devel/12761 If there's a better place to make this question, please point me to the right place and close this issue. Thanks in advance! :-) -- Ticket URL: <http://trac.macports.org/ticket/17851> MacPorts <http://www.macports.org/> Ports system for Mac OS